Ha. Kirst et al., IDENTIFICATION AND SYNTHESIS OF PRODUCTS ISOLATED DURING METABOLISM STUDIES OF TILMICOSIN, Journal of agricultural and food chemistry, 42(5), 1994, pp. 1219-1222
Two substances, designated T-1 and T-2, were isolated during metabolis
m studies with tilmicosin, a new veterinary macrolide antibiotic. By c
ombination of mass spectrometry and NMR spectroscopy, T-1 was identifi
ed as N-demethyltilmicosin and T-2 was assigned a dimeric structure re
sulting from reductive coupling of desmycosin with T-1. T-1 was synthe
sized by selective N-demethylation of tilmicosin, using K3Fe(CN)(6) in
aqueous 2-propanol. T-2 was synthesized by reductive amination of des
mycosin with T-1 using NaBH3CN. The synthetic compounds were identical
with the respective isolated materials, thereby confirming the struct
ural assignments for both compounds.
